Chocolate-Covered Peanuts

Chocolate-covered peanuts are a classic treat combining the crunch of roasted peanuts with the smoothness of melted chocolate. A simple, homemade version allows for customization with different chocolate types and flavor enhancements.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Cooling Time 15 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 8 servings
Course: Dessert, Snack
Cuisine: American
Calories: 170

Ingredients
  

Chocolate Coating
  • 1 ½ cups chocolate (milk, dark, or white) high-quality recommended
  • 1 tsp coconut oil or butter optional, for smoother coating
Peanuts
  • 2 cups roasted peanuts salted or unsalted
  • sea salt optional, for extra flavor

Equipment

  • Double Boiler or Microwave
  • Parchment Paper

Method
 

  1. Melt the chocolate using a double boiler or microwave in 20-second bursts, stirring between each to prevent burning.
  2. If using, mix in the coconut oil or butter for a smoother coating.
  3. Stir the roasted peanuts into the melted chocolate, ensuring they are fully covered.
  4. Using a spoon or fork, scoop out clusters or individual pieces and place them on a parchment-lined tray.
  5. Sprinkle with sea salt or any additional toppings if desired.
  6. Refrigerate for 15 minutes or until the chocolate hardens.
  7. Once fully set, enjoy immediately or store in an airtight container for up to two weeks.

Notes

Customize with different chocolates or add-ins like caramel drizzle, chili flakes, or crushed candy for unique flavors.
